How to use SEA Spot Saver, the line-skipping service at SeaTac Airport
The SEA Spot Saver program at Seattle-Tacoma International Airport offers a valuable solution for travelers worried about long security lines. Operating daily from 5 a. m. to 10 p. m.
, it allows users to reserve TSA screening times online, enhancing their overall airport experience. To utilize the service, travelers can visit the SEA Spot Saver website or use the flySEA app to enter their flight details and select a convenient screening time. After receiving a confirmation email, users simply present their appointment confirmation at designated TSA checkpoints. While the service is free, ongoing construction has temporarily closed Checkpoint 5, leading to limited availability.
